Which consequence results inside a refrigeration cycle when compressor overheating causes lubricant breakdown?

A)Reduced heat exchanger surface area
B)Decreased system coefficient of performance
C)Increased refrigerant subcooling temperature
D)Enhanced evaporator coil moisture removal

💡 Explanation

Compressor overheating causes lubricant breakdown which prompts increased friction and declining compression efficiency. This lowers the system's cooling capacity because the COP declines rather than remaining stable, therefore the intended cooling weakens rather than improves.
